York police searching for escaped prisoner at hospital

by Conservative Times

YORK, PA – Police are searching for a prisoner who was getting treatment at an area hospital after he fled the hospital and eluded police.

Police obtained an arrest warrant for 26-year-old Ishan S. Phinn after he escaped from York Hospital while under official detention by a corrections officer from York County Prison on Sunday.

Phinn was initially apprehended on Friday while resisting arrest and fleeing on foot from an investigation on the 200 block of Masonic Drive in Manchester Township, York County.

Phinn faced charges of resisting arrest, flight to avoid apprehension, and possession of a small amount of marijuana.

Anyone with information on Phinn’s whereabouts is asked to contact PSP-York at 717-428-1011.
